1st Logo (1996-2001)


Visuals: On a white background, there is a blue bar flying to the top, spinning a couple of times. A white sunburst rises in the bar. At the same time, a green W unfolds itself, and individual letters in the text "WELLSPRING MEDIA", in the same color as the W, turn into place. The e-mail address and website link for the company appear below the logo. It stays on screen for another 13 seconds, then, we fade to black.

Technique: CGI.

Audio: A breathy synthesized orchestra jingle.

Availability: Seen on several specialty tapes from the company, particularly from the 1990s.

2nd Logo (2001-2006)


Visuals: The camera rotates around a landscape with a waterfall. As this happens, the logo, an abstract waterdrop, flies in. After that, the text "WELLSPRING" appears and the camera stops, with the background becoming bluer and blurry.

Technique: CGI.

Audio: A remix over the first logo's jingle, only with a different style.

Availability: Unknown.
